A. Travelling is very popular among students in Britain. They don’t have a lot of
money, so it has to be cheap. But there are many ways of travelling at low cost.
B. The cheapest way to travel is hitchhiking, but this isn’t reliable and it can be
dangerous. So it’s better to use normal public transport. If you want to travel by
train, you can get a student railcard. With this you can get a discount,
C. If you want to travel by air, this isn’t expensive as it sounds. There are a lot of
shops (called, called “bucket shops”) which sell cheap airline tickets to the
countries like the USA, Thailand and Australia. They advertise in magazines and
newspapers.
D. Magazines often have adverts for “overland” tours especially to Africa and India,
or Latin America. On these tours you travel with a group in a mini-bus. It isn’t
very comfortable and you have to share the cooking, but it’s a cheap way to see
parts of the world that most tourists never go to.
E.
While British young people are travelling to Africa and the Far East, many young
people from Australia and New Zealand travel to Britain. They get cheap airline
tickets to London. Then they usually travel around Europe in a mini-van.
